Is Fort Thomas or Louisville Metro Safer?

According to crimebycity.com's analysis of 2024 FBI data, Fort Thomas is safer than Louisville Metro (Safety Score 91/100 vs 8/100), with a total crime rate of 535 per 100,000 versus 4,035 for Louisville Metro — 87% lower. Fort Thomas has lower rates in 7 of 7 crime categories.

The biggest difference is in murder, where Fort Thomas has a 100% lower rate.

Note: Louisville Metro is 40.2x larger by coverage, which can affect crime rate comparisons. Larger cities tend to report higher rates due to density and more comprehensive reporting.

Detailed Crime Rate Comparison

Crime Type Fort Thomas Louisville Metro Difference
Total Crime Rate 534.9 4,034.8 -3,499.9
Violent Crime Rate 47.6 708.6 -661.0
Murder Rate 0.0 21.7 -21.7
Rape Rate 23.8 30.7 -7.0
Robbery Rate 5.9 128.2 -122.3
Aggravated Assault Rate 17.8 526.7 -508.9
Property Crime Rate 487.3 3,326.2 -2,838.8
Burglary Rate 47.6 455.6 -408.1
Larceny-Theft Rate 380.4 2,086.6 -1,706.2
Motor Vehicle Theft Rate 59.4 783.9 -724.5

All rates per 100,000 residents. Source: FBI UCR 2024.

About Fort Thomas, KY

Fort Thomas, Kentucky, a hilltop city overlooking the Ohio River, boasts a rich military history, once home to a significant US Army post. This affluent suburban community in Campbell County is known for its tree-lined streets and well-preserved early 20th-century architecture. With a safety score of 91/100 and a population coverage of 16,826, Fort Thomas has a total crime rate of 534.9 per 100,000 residents.

About Louisville Metro, KY

Louisville Metro, Kentucky, home of the Kentucky Derby, sprawls along the Ohio River. This consolidated city-county is Kentucky's most populous, with a diverse urban and suburban landscape. With a safety score of 8/100 and a population coverage of 676,843, Louisville Metro has a total crime rate of 4,034.8 per 100,000 residents.
